> [3] Can EMC handle metric in it's setup? I know it can do G20/21 butYes EMC can be configured for metric. I think I remember that Ian said
> will it display metric?
something about having to vary some not so obvious setting to get the
decimal place correct on the display, but it is supported.
> [4] Does the BDI install cover the stepper step and direction optionBDI covers steppers and servos.
> or is it just for servo's?
> [5] if it does and I believe it's called steppermod? what more wouldThere are 3 stepper modules. Steppermod, freqmod, and smdromod. I just
> be required other than a PC, BDI, and 3 G320's on the control side?
> Obviously I need 3 motors, 3 encoders and a power supply on the drive
> side.
checked and all three are in the BDI, but smdromod seems to have some errors
and will not come up. Other than what you mentioned all you need is a cable
and some type of junction board to connect all three drives to the parallel
port. Can be done without, but worth the money.
